Renormalization-group approach is applied to investigate the short-time nonequilibriumcritical behavior of pure and diluted spin systems with nonmagnetic point-like impurities.The dissipative relaxation dynamics with non-conserved order parameter is considered. For thefirst time the description of the order parameter growth induced by the initial nonequilibriumstate of system is carried out at fixed dimension d = 3 without use of ε-expansion.
